What does 'look unto me' mean in the context of salvation?

Answered in 1 source

'Look unto me' signifies faith in Christ alone for salvation and deliverance.

The phrase 'look unto me' as expressed in Isaiah 45:22 implies that salvation is found solely in Christ, who fulfills all the requirements for redemption. This act of looking represents faith, indicating a reliance on Christ's work and His promises for salvation. Just as the Israelites were instructed to look at the bronze serpent and be healed, believers today are called to look to Christ as the source of their hope and salvation. This looking is not a mere glance but involves deep trust and commitment to the Savior, recognizing Him as the only one who can provide eternal life and reconciliation with God.
Scripture References: Isaiah 45:22, John 3:14-15
